Rihanna also happens to be one of the most stylish stars on the planet, as evidenced by her Style Icon honor at the 2014 CFDA Awards and her many appearances at the Met Gala.
Rihanna first attended the gala in 2007, and continues to the crush the theme year after year. In 2018, she stepped things up a notch as she served as one of the hosts. Needless to say, we can't wait to see what she comes up with next. Ahead, look back at her best Met Gala moments from years past.

For the 2017 gala, which was a tribute to Comme des Garcons designer Rei Kawakubo, Rihanna came to slay: not only did she wear this amazingly detailed ruffled ensemble from the brand, but her strappy DSquared heels took her an hour to get into. A fashion queen!
Rihanna stuck to the theme, "Heavenly Bodies: Fashion and the Catholic Imagination," by wearing a bedazzled pope-inspired outfit by Margiela.
